He comenzado a desarrollar un uso interesante del PHP para el apilado de la L�MPARA (Linux-Apache-MySQL-PHP). Tengo que decir que ha sido una experiencia maravillosa hasta ahora.

Es algo simple (realmente simple) y f�cil fijar los peque�os armazones (funciones para uso general le�das en un archivo) en el PHP para sus tareas. El PHP tiene un arsenal delicioso de funcionalidades a utilizar. Usted tiene un muy corto c�digo-prueba-elimina errores del ciclo, configuraci�n muy peque�a requerida, si cualquiera.

Usted no tiene que pensar en liberar los recursos, PHP la hace para usted (colecci�n de basura como Java).
Debido al sistema de referencia-cuenta introdujo con el motor del PHP 4 Zend, �l se detecta autom�ticamente cuando un recurso se refiere no m�s (apenas como Java). Cuando �ste es el caso, todos los recursos que eran funcionando para este recurso son hechos libres por el colector de basura. Por esta raz�n, es raramente siempre necesario liberar la memoria manualmente usando una cierta funci�n del free_result.

Tengo gusto del hecho de que no tengo que dejar en desorden mi c�digo con intentar-cojo bloques pero puedo utilizarlos cuando est� necesitado.

El apoyo de enchufes en su uso es simple porque usted puede desarrollar r�pidamente un motor primitivo de la regla de negocio basado en la capacidad para invocar funciones por nombre. Entonces usted puede especificar los ganchos en su c�digo donde se invocan las funciones que se han colocado (en ese gancho). Vea la puesta en pr�ctica de WordPress para un ejemplo trivial. Pienso que escribir� un art�culo separado en esto con un cierto c�digo.

Dos otras sutilezas son la capacidad de llamar funciones por nombre y eval para evaluar cualquier c�digo. Usando eval usted puede definir los constantes de la secuencia que se eval�an y se ejecutan realmente en el tiempo de pasada para agregar funcionalidades.

Hay algunas desventajas que hab�a cubierto anterior, comprueba tambi�n los acoplamientos abajo.

El PHP total ofrece una buenos lengua y ambiente para el desarrollo r�pido de la aplicaci�n web.